Art galleries are big business, contributing to a $45 billion dollar global industry based on this model. However, the internet and cost of real estate in the world's top cities has increasingly rattled the relevance of art galleries.
The profit an art gallery can make is variable. Bloomberg reports that the average profit margin for this kind of business is 6.5 percent. Obviously, the amount of profit is tied to the amount of art sold and the price of that art. Almost every art gallery – at least, every successful art gallery that's able to stick around long-term – makes money in some way. Most art galleries aren't in it for the money, but of course, they need some revenue in order to keep their doors open.
In collaboration with many collectors and artists, “gallery owners” have also defined a set of criteria for evaluating the professionalism of galleries: loyalty to artists, commitment to their success, ethics, accessibility to the public, provision of services to collectors and more.
A commercial gallery is a for-profit business with a transactional model: collectors buy pieces of artwork on display so both the gallery and the artist get a cut of the revenue. These spaces typically curate selective shows based on what's likely to sell (by extension boosting their reputation in the art world).
